In Viseu de Sus, Romania, August offers a warm and dynamic climate, characterized by a maximum temperature reaching up to 29°C (85°F) and a comfortable average of 17°C (62°F). Despite the summer warmth, residents and visitors may experience cooler nights with temperatures dipping to a brisk 3°C (38°F). This month sees significant precipitation, totaling 108 mm (4.2 in), spread over 14 days, contributing to a humidity level of 55%. In August, Viseu de Sus experiences a notable dip in humidity, with levels falling to a comfortable 55%. This marks the lowest point of the year, a stark contrast to the 93% humidity recorded in January. As summer approaches its close, the trend shows a gradual decrease in moisture from the peak of 71% in both June and July, signaling a shift towards drier conditions. In Viseu de Sus, Romania, August brings a delightful 14 hours of daylight, marking a gentle decline from the peak summer months of June and July, which enjoy a consistent 15 hours. As summer begins to give way to autumn, the daylight hours gradually shorten, reflecting a broader trend throughout the year: from a modest 8 hours in January to a vibrant 15 hours in the late spring and summer months, then tapering back to 9 hours by November.
